Long Island chapter of Turnaround Management Association names new
Long Island Business News, Dec 13, 2002 by Rosamaria Mancini
Jeffrey A. Wurst, partner at Ruskin Moscou Faltischek and chair of the firm's financial services, banking and bankruptcy department, has been named president of the Long Island chapter of Turnaround Management Association.
Wurst's experience in asset-based lending and other areas of commercial finance, bankruptcy matters, workouts and turnaround situations is the right fit for the non-profit association that is focused on corporate renewal and turnaround management.
Wurst is also active in the documentation of commercial finance and leasing transactions and the litigation that arises with such transactions.
The Turnaround Management Association brings together those interested in corporate restructuring such as lawyers, consultants, managers, accountants, lenders and investors for the purpose of professional advancement and exchange of knowledge.
